How to Choose the Perfect Folding Low Table for Camping! A Comprehensive Guide to Comparison Points That Will Prevent Regrets

The comfort of your camping experience depends not only on chairs and tents, but also significantly on your choice of table. Among these, folding low tables are essential tools that determine the usability of low-style camping. Issues such as the wrong height, a narrow tabletop, difficulty storing the table, wobbling on the ground, or difficulty using it near a campfire are common pitfalls, especially for those new to camping.

In this article, we focus exclusively on folding low tables for camping, covering everything from basic selection criteria and considerations based on intended use, to key comparison points, safety tips, maintenance methods, and how to choose based on the season. We’ve organized the key factors you should consider before deciding which table to buy, so this single article provides all the essential foundational knowledge you need. Please use it as a reference.

What Is a Folding Low Table? How Does It Differ from Other Tables?

First, let’s clarify exactly what a “folding low table” refers to. This article focuses on tables that can be folded for compact storage and feature a low tabletop height suitable for low-style camping. Similar categories include roll-up tables, IGT-compatible tables, and irori tables, but the selection criteria differ slightly for each.

Roll-up tables often feature a design where the tabletop is rolled up for storage; while they offer excellent portability, their setup and stability differ from those of folding low tables. IGT-compatible tables offer high expandability, and hearth tables are specialized for use around a campfire. If you’re a beginner choosing your first table, focusing on a folding low table is the safest bet.

When a folding low table is a good choice

Folding low tables are particularly well-suited for those who want to enjoy sitting on the ground or in a traditional Japanese-style floor setting. They are also a great choice for those who want to pair them with low chairs, those looking to minimize a sense of confinement inside a tent, and those who want to make setup and takedown as easy as possible.

Folding low tables are also very practical for family camping. The lower seating height makes it easier to interact with children and pets, and helps create a more relaxed layout inside the tent. Since they don’t have as strong a presence as high tables, they’re also ideal for those who want their campsite to feel spacious.

Situations Where a Folding Low Table Isn’t Ideal

That said, a folding low table isn’t the best choice for everyone. If you’re backpacking or hiking and prioritize extreme lightweight and packability above all else, an ultra-lightweight mini table might be a better fit. If you plan to use a campfire or hot pots, a metal model designed for heat resistance might offer greater peace of mind.

Furthermore, if you plan to reconfigure the tabletop or integrate a burner or other units in the future, an IGT-style system table becomes a strong contender. The key is not to view a folding low table as a one-size-fits-all solution. Deciding in advance what you prioritize and what you’re willing to compromise on based on your camping style will make your choice much clearer.

How to Choose a Folding Low Table for Camping Without Regrets

To avoid making a mistake when choosing a folding low table, it’s important not to base your decision solely on appearance or popularity. In reality, factors like height, tabletop size, portability, stability, heat resistance, and material differences significantly impact usability.

It’s easy to rely solely on the specs listed on a product page, but when camping, it’s essential to consider practical factors from a real-world perspective: “Is it comfortable to use when actually sitting at it?” “Does it stay stable on uneven ground?” and “Can I use it safely near a campfire?” Below, we’ll explain the key points you should really look for when choosing a folding low table, in order.

How to Choose the Height

Many comparison articles suggest that a height of 30–40 cm is a good guideline for folding low tables. However, that alone is not enough. In reality, the ideal height varies depending on how you sit and how you plan to use the table.

If you primarily sit on the floor or on a tatami mat, a tabletop height of around 25–35 cm is often easiest to use. If it’s higher than this, you’ll have to raise your arms more often, making it hard to relax; conversely, if it’s too low, you’ll have to lean forward, making it difficult to eat or work. If you’re using low chairs, aiming for a height of around 35–45 cm makes it easier to reach for dishes and drinks.

Furthermore, the ideal height varies depending on whether the table is for dining, assisting with cooking, or organizing a laptop and small items. For dining, the ideal height allows your elbows to rest naturally; for cooking, a slightly higher height is better; and for laptop work, a height that prevents you from leaning forward too much is ideal.If you’re unsure, measure the seat height of your chair and use a height slightly lower than where your elbows rest when seated as a guideline—this will help you avoid mistakes. When choosing a folding low table, the key is not “how many centimeters” it is, but whether it suits your sitting style.

How to Choose the Tabletop Size

When choosing the tabletop size for a folding low table, you need to consider not only the number of people but also the intended use. For example, even for solo camping, a smaller size is sufficient if you’re just eating, but if you want to place cooking utensils, cutlery, drinks, and a lantern on it, you’ll need quite a bit of space.

If you’re using it alone and focusing on eating, a compact tabletop will suffice, but if you also want to cook or organize small items, a slightly larger size is more reassuring. For two people, the required space changes depending on whether you’ll place a pot or burner in the center in addition to dishes. For family camping, be sure to distinguish between using it as a main table or a side table. For a main table, width and stability are key, while for a side table, quick setup and ease of storage take priority.

Even if it looks stylish, a narrow tabletop can easily lead to frustration when you find you “can’t quite fit what you want to put down.” Conversely, if it’s too large, it compromises portability and increases weight. When choosing a folding low table, it’s important to consider not only the number of users but also to visualize specifically whether it will be used for dining, cooking, or as a side table.

How to Evaluate Storage Efficiency

When evaluating storage, many people tend to judge based solely on whether it’s “folding” or “roll-up” style. However, in reality, it’s more practical to consider the thickness, length, weight, and even the ease of use of the storage bag when assessing the storage capabilities of a folding low table.

The strength of a folding low table lies in the fact that it can be folded with a single action and stored flat. However, some models remain long even when folded flat, so while they may fit easily into gaps in a car, they can be difficult to carry on foot or during motorcycle camping. To avoid disappointment, consider not just the numerical storage dimensions, but also the orientation in which it can be packed, whether it fits easily into a container, and whether it’s suitable for attaching to the outside of a backpack.

Furthermore, even if a storage bag is included, there are subtle differences: the handles might be too thin and dig into your hands, the opening might be too narrow to pack items easily, or the bag might take a long time to dry if it gets wet. When camping, the time spent transporting and packing up gear can often feel longer than the time spent actually using it. That’s why it’s crucial to evaluate a folding low table not just on whether it “stows away” easily, but also on whether it’s “easy to carry.”

How to Assess Weight Capacity and Stability

While product descriptions for folding low tables often highlight high weight capacity figures, you shouldn’t rely on that alone. What truly determines usability isn’t the weight capacity itself, but whether the table remains stable when loaded.

For example, even if the weight capacity is sufficient, if the legs don’t spread wide enough, the table is prone to wobbling side-to-side. With models that don’t have secure leg locks, the table may appear stable during setup, but it can become unstable when dishes are placed on it or when weight is applied to the edge. Campground surfaces aren’t always flat—conditions vary from gravel to dirt, grass, or mud—so the contact area of the leg tips and the leg structure are also crucial.

Folding low tables, in particular, become much harder to use if they wobble on uneven ground. While these details are rarely listed in spec sheets, factors like how the legs spread, whether they have locks, the stability of the center of gravity, and how much the tabletop flexes when pressed are key points that make a difference in the field. By looking beyond just the numbers and considering whether the table “seems resistant to wobbling” or “seems unlikely to sink into the ground,” you can minimize the risk of making a poor choice.

How to Assess Heat Resistance

For those who want to use a folding low table near a campfire, heat resistance is crucial. However, heat resistance isn’t determined solely by whether the table is made of wood or metal. You need to check not only the tabletop material but also the surface finish, the tabletop structure, whether it’s made of mesh or solid panels, and whether a trivet is required.

Folding low tables with wooden tops look great and create a nice atmosphere, but many models aren’t suitable for placing hot pots directly on them. They can easily get scorched by sparks, and the surface finish may be damaged. Aluminum is lightweight and easy to handle, but thin tops can be vulnerable to localized heat. Stainless steel and steel are relatively heat-resistant and easy to use around campfires, but they tend to be heavier as a result.

Additionally, mesh tabletops are resistant to sparks and do not trap heat easily, but they can make it difficult to place small items. Solid tabletops are easy to use but are often susceptible to heat damage. If you plan to use a folding low table near a campfire, it is essential to consider not only whether it is “heat-resistant” but also “how safe it is,” “whether a trivet is necessary,” and “whether it can withstand sparks.”

Characteristics by Material

The material of a folding low table significantly affects not only its appearance but also its weight, heat resistance, ease of maintenance, and suitability for various usage scenarios. Understanding the characteristics of each material will help you determine which option best suits your needs.

Wooden tables offer a warm, inviting look and blend seamlessly into the overall campsite atmosphere. They pair well with a low-profile camping style and are ideal for those who want to create a stylish campsite. However, you need to be careful with moisture and heat, and regular maintenance is essential.

Aluminum is lightweight and easy to handle, making it a popular choice for beginners. It’s easy to carry and requires minimal effort to set up and take down, making it ideal for solo camping or motorcycle camping. On the other hand, depending on the model, prioritizing lightness can sometimes result in slightly reduced stability.

Stainless steel offers excellent heat resistance and durability, making it a great choice for use near campfires. It’s easy to wipe clean, which is appealing to those who plan to use it heavily. However, it tends to be heavier, making it somewhat cumbersome to carry.

Steel is also heat-resistant and offers solid stability, but you need to be careful about rust. It deteriorates easily if left wet, so it’s best suited for those who don’t mind regular maintenance. When choosing a folding low table, it’s important to select a material that matches not only your aesthetic preferences but also your mode of transportation and intended use.

How to Choose a Folding Low Table for Each Season

While folding coffee tables can be used year-round, the key considerations actually vary by season.

Even the same model may be comfortable in spring and fall but difficult to use in summer, winter, or rainy weather. Here, we’ll outline the key points to consider when choosing a folding coffee table for each season.

Spring and Fall Camping

Spring and fall tend to have stable weather, making them ideal seasons for assessing the usability of a folding low table. Since the effects of heat, cold, condensation, and freezing are minimal, these seasons are also a good time to choose a versatile model that strikes a balance between weight, size, and stability.

If you’re choosing your first table, a folding low table designed with these spring and fall seasons in mind will likely be the easiest to handle. Models that are neither too light nor too heavy, neither too large nor too small, and suitable for both dining and relaxing tend to remain easy to use for a long time.

Summer Camping

In summer, with more opportunities to place drinks, coolers, and cold food items on the table, you’re more likely to notice sticky surfaces, condensation, and lingering moisture. When choosing a folding low table, keeping heat and humidity resistance in mind will ensure a more comfortable experience.

Metal tabletops are easy to wipe clean and handle condensation well, but they can get hot in direct sunlight. Wooden tabletops have a nice atmosphere, but they’re prone to damage if moisture or dirt is left on them, so frequent dry wiping and drying are essential. If you factor in post-use care when planning for summer, you’ll be less likely to regret your choice.

Winter Camping

During winter camping, opportunities to use campfires, stoves, and hot pots increase, making the heat resistance of your folding low table even more critical. If you choose a wooden table primarily for its appearance, it may be prone to damage from sparks or direct heat.

If you plan to use it in winter, prioritize metal tabletops or materials with high heat resistance. If you do use a wooden or painted tabletop, it’s safer to assume you’ll need a trivet. Be mindful of the distance from the campfire; simply avoiding positions where sparks are likely to fly can significantly reduce damage. In winter, prioritizing “safety” over “style” is the way to avoid disappointment.

Rainy Days & Wet Ground

On rainy days or at campsites after rain, the weaknesses of folding low tables tend to become apparent. On muddy ground, the legs can easily sink, and gravel or mud can accumulate, putting strain on the hinges.

Additionally, storing metal tables while they’re still wet can cause rust, and leaving the storage bag damp can lead to odors and deterioration. If you plan to use it frequently on wet ground, look for a design where the legs are less likely to sink or a material that dries easily after use. If you anticipate using it in the rain, it’s important to consider maintenance after purchase as well.

How to Choose the Best Folding Low Table Based on Your Needs

The ideal design for a folding low table varies significantly depending on the situation. Rather than simply copying popular models, choosing a style that suits your specific needs will lead to greater satisfaction.

Here, we’ll outline which folding low tables to choose for typical uses such as solo camping, family camping, around a campfire, inside a tent, and for a traditional Japanese-style seating arrangement.

For Solo Camping | Prioritize Lightweight, Compact, and Quick Setup

For solo camping, the priorities for a folding low table are clear. The key is that it’s lightweight, compact, and ready to use immediately. For styles involving hiking, biking, or backpacking, lightweight models weighing a few hundred grams to just over a kilogram are the top choice.

However, if you prioritize lightness alone, the tabletop may be too narrow, making it difficult to eat or cook. It’s important to understand the difference between models designed more like mini-tables and those meant to function as full-fledged low tables, and to consider exactly what you’ll be placing on them. Even when camping solo, if you want to set out not just food but also coffee gear or a small lantern, a slightly wider folding low table will be more practical.

For Family Camping | Prioritize Space, Stability, and Safety

For family camping, a spacious tabletop and stability are essential. The table should be easy for multiple people to gather around, not feel cramped even when placing dishes and pots, and be resistant to tipping over if children touch it.

For this purpose, prioritizing stability over lightness will help you avoid mistakes. Look for models with secure leg locks, a wide leg spread, and rounded edges that aren’t too sharp—these are key points to consider for family use. While folding low tables provide a sense of security due to their low height, it’s also crucial to ensure they’re designed to prevent uneven weight distribution.

For Use Around Campfires | Prioritize Metal Tops, Heat Resistance, and Resistance to Sparks

When choosing a folding low table for use around a campfire, heat resistance should be your top priority. If you plan to place hot kettles or pots on it, consider the material and tabletop construction first and foremost.

Metal tabletops, especially those made of stainless steel or steel, are a practical choice for use near a campfire.Mesh tabletops are relatively resistant to sparks and have the advantage of not trapping heat. On the other hand, while models with wooden or painted tabletops may look nice, caution is required when using them near a campfire. For folding low tables with unclear heat resistance, it’s safest to use them with a trivet. When choosing for use near a campfire, you won’t go wrong if you judge based on “how safely it can be used” rather than simply “whether it can be used.”

For Use Inside Tents or on the Floor | Prioritize Low Height, Rounded Edges, and Minimal Clutter

For folding low tables used inside tents, low height and a lack of a cramped feeling are essential. If the table is too tall, it makes the space feel cramped and gets in the way when entering or exiting. If you primarily use a floor-seating style, a particularly low and easy-to-handle model is ideal.

Additionally, since movement is limited inside a tent, you’ll want to be mindful of sharp corners that could cause injury. A compact, stable folding low table that doesn’t dominate the space works well in a tent. If you choose a model with adjustable height, you can easily switch between using it with low chairs outdoors and for floor seating inside the tent.

Criteria for Comparing Folding Low Tables

キャンプで折りたたみローテーブルを使っている様子

Articles about folding low tables often end with a simple “list of recommended models,” but to truly make the selection process easier, it’s important to standardize the criteria for comparison. If the comparison criteria are all over the place, you’ll end up unsure which one is right for you.

Here, we summarize the criteria you should compare before purchasing and how to interpret them.

Criteria to Compare

When comparing folding low tables, check the basic specifications such as height, unfolded size, folded size, weight, weight capacity, material, and heat resistance. However, that alone isn’t enough. In actual camping situations, on-site factors like ease of setup, whether it has leg locks, stability on uneven ground, whether a storage bag is included, and whether you can place hot pots directly on it will be the deciding factors.

If possible, you should also consider the time it takes to set up, the number of steps involved, how it feels to carry, and how easy it is to load into a car. Since the difference between folding low tables often lies not just in numbers but in “how much of a hassle they are to use,” be sure to thoroughly check information that isn’t easily found in official specifications.

What to Prioritize and What to Compromise On

When comparing specs, it’s important to understand what you’ll prioritize and what you’ll have to compromise on, rather than searching for a model that meets every requirement. If you prioritize lightness, stability and heat resistance tend to suffer. If you prioritize size, the weight and storage dimensions tend to increase. If you prioritize heat resistance, metal models become more common, and they tend to be heavier to carry.

In other words, choosing a folding low table is a matter of subtraction, not addition. Avoiding the mistakes that would cause you the most trouble leads to a choice that brings the highest satisfaction. By setting priorities—such as weight and portability for solo use, surface area and stability for families, or heat resistance for campfire use—you can significantly narrow down your options.

Tips for Using a Folding Low Table Safely

While folding low tables are easy to use, a lack of safety knowledge can lead to trouble. Especially when used near campfires, on uneven ground, or on windy days, even a small judgment error can result in inconvenience or accidents.

Here, we summarize key points for safe usage that will be helpful after your purchase. Going beyond just comparing products and ensuring you understand how to use them safely will make this article much more practical.

Precautions When Using Near a Campfire

When using a folding low table near a campfire, you must be cautious of both sparks and heat distortion. Wooden tabletops are prone to scorching from sparks and their surface finishes can be easily damaged, making them more delicate than they appear. Even metal tables may have parts that are vulnerable to high temperatures, depending on their finish or construction.

When placing hot pots or Dutch ovens on the table, it’s safer to use a trivet if the heat resistance rating is unclear. Additionally, placing the table too close to the fire pit can cause heat damage even if you don’t place the pot directly on it. The correct approach for a folding low table isn’t “the closer to the fire, the better,” but rather “a convenient position while maintaining a safe distance.”

Tips for Preventing Wobbling on Uneven or Gravel Surfaces

Completely flat ground is actually quite rare at campsites. On gravel, grass, or dirt sites, the legs of a folding low table can lift or sink, making it prone to wobbling.

To prevent wobbling, the basic rule is to first carefully inspect the setup area and choose the flattest surface possible. Beyond that, small adjustments like repositioning the legs, placing heavy items toward the center, and avoiding concentrating weight at the edges can make a difference. Models with thin leg tips are prone to sinking, so be especially careful on soft ground. Since folding low tables are easy to set up, choosing the right spot is key to their usability.

How to Use on Windy Days

Lightweight folding low tables are more susceptible to being blown over than you might expect on windy days. Models with wide, lightweight tabletops are particularly prone to instability depending on the balance of items placed on them.

On windy days, it’s important not to place dishes or cookware too close to the edges and to arrange items so the center of gravity isn’t skewed. It’s also effective to avoid leaving empty plates or paper items lying around and to group lightweight small items together. While wind resistance is not easily indicated in the specs, it directly affects actual usability.

How to Maintain a Folding Low Table

Buying a folding low table isn’t the end of the story. In fact, to use it comfortably for a long time, post-use maintenance is crucial. Knowing how to care for it based on its materials and construction can significantly extend its lifespan.

In particular, wooden tabletops, metal parts, moving components, and storage bags all deteriorate differently. To reduce post-purchase concerns, make sure to master the basics of maintenance.

Maintenance for Wooden Tables

For wooden folding coffee tables, the basic rule is to wipe off any dirt after use and let them dry thoroughly. Storing them while still wet can cause stains, warping, or mold. However, drying them too quickly under strong direct sunlight can lead to cracking or deformation, so it’s best to let them dry in a well-ventilated, shaded area.

Once the surface has dried, applying oil or wax as needed will help preserve its natural finish. While the charm of a wooden folding coffee table lies in its atmosphere, you’ll be more satisfied if you use it with the understanding that it requires a little care.

Maintenance of Aluminum, Stainless Steel, and Steel

For folding low tables made of aluminum, stainless steel, or steel, it is essential to thoroughly wipe away dirt and moisture. Steel, in particular, requires attention to rust; since salt residue tends to remain after use near the beach, be sure to wipe it down carefully after each use.

Stainless steel is relatively resistant to rust, but that doesn’t mean you can completely neglect it. If mud or moisture is left on the surface, dirt will become ingrained, and the appearance will deteriorate. Aluminum is lightweight and easy to handle, but if you leave fine scratches or dirt unattended, signs of wear will become more noticeable. Even with heat-resistant materials, assuming they require no maintenance will shorten their lifespan.

Maintenance of Moving Parts, Hinges, and Leg Locks

One aspect often overlooked with folding coffee tables is the care of moving parts, hinges, and leg locks. If sand or mud gets stuck in them, opening and closing the table becomes difficult, and forcing it to fold can cause deformation or damage.

After use, check the hinges and joints for dirt, and if necessary, remove it with a soft brush or cloth before letting the table dry. For safety, avoid using excessive force to fold the table if it’s not moving smoothly. While folding coffee tables are convenient, remember that the more moving parts they have, the more important maintenance becomes.

Maintenance of the Storage Bag

The storage bag may seem like a supporting role, but it is actually prone to wear and tear. If you put a wet table directly into the bag, moisture will build up inside, leading to odors and mold. If mud or sand remains on the table, it can also accelerate damage to the fabric.

After use, it’s best to spread out the storage bag itself to dry and, if necessary, lightly remove any dirt. Cleaning only the folding low table itself is pointless if the inside of the bag remains damp. To ensure long-lasting, comfortable use, make it a habit to maintain the bag as well.

How to Buy and Replace a Folding Low Table

A folding low table isn’t something you buy once and forget about; it’s a piece of gear you’ll likely reassess as your camping style evolves. It’s common to start with a versatile model and then add on a secondary table, a table for the campfire, or an extension piece later on.

Here, we’ll outline how beginners should approach choosing their first table and how to add to their collection with subsequent purchases.

Choosing Your First Table as a Beginner

If you’re buying a folding low table for the first time, we recommend a versatile model that strikes a balance between height, stability, and portability, rather than an extremely specialized one. A size that works well for both solo and duo camping, and is easy to use both inside and outside the tent, will minimize the risk of making a mistake.

When considering price, it’s practical not to jump straight into the high-end market, but rather to choose something that meets your essential needs. If you set weight capacity, a comfortable height, and a compact storage size as your minimum requirements, you’ll make a much better choice for your first table.

If you’re adding a second or auxiliary table

When choosing a second folding low table, you won’t go wrong if you select one to address the shortcomings of your first one. For example, if your main table is heavy, add a lightweight sub-table. If your main table is made of wood and you’re concerned about campfires, add a metal one designed for campfires. If you plan to reconfigure your gear in the future, consider IGT-style or expandable models.

In many cases, dividing roles by purpose is more comfortable in the long run than aiming for an all-in-one solution from the start. If you think of folding low tables as tools where the optimal solution changes between your “first one” and the “next one you add,” you’ll be less likely to regret your purchase even if you decide to replace it later.

Frequently Asked Questions About Folding Low Tables

With so many types of folding low tables and so many detailed comparison points, this is a category where it’s easy to get confused before buying. Here, we’ve compiled answers to the most frequently searched basic questions.

What is the ideal height for a folding low table?

Generally, 30–40 cm is the standard, but the ideal height depends on how you sit. For floor-seating style, 25–35 cm is often comfortable, while 35–45 cm works well with low chairs. The surest way to decide is to check if it matches the seat height of your own chair.

Can wooden folding low tables be used near a campfire?

In some cases, yes, but caution is needed when placing it near an open flame or directly on a hot pot. Since sparks can cause scorching or damage the surface finish, it’s safer to keep a safe distance and use a trivet if necessary. If you’ll be using it mainly around a campfire, it’s safer to consider a metal table with higher heat resistance.

Which is easier to use: folding or roll-up styles?

For beginners, folding tables are often more intuitive and easier to set up and take down. Roll-up tables may offer better storage efficiency, but they can feel more like a construction project, and stability varies depending on the model. A sensible approach is to start by choosing a folding low table for ease of use, and then consider a roll-up table if needed.

What weight capacity is recommended for peace of mind?

The required weight capacity depends on your intended use. If it’s just for solo meals, a high weight capacity isn’t necessary, but for use as a main family table or for placing a pot, a higher weight capacity provides greater peace of mind. What’s important isn’t just the numerical value, but also whether the structure remains stable when weight is applied.

Can folding low tables be used inside a tent?

They work well together. Since they are low-profile and don’t feel overwhelming, they help maximize the usable space inside the tent. However, if the table is too large, it can obstruct entry and exit, and sharp corners can be a tripping hazard, so be sure to check for compactness and safety.
